The first impression
Moon Rose by Nosegasm is a Chypre Floral fragrance for women and men. Moon Rose was launched in 2020. The nose behind this fragrance is Michael Boadi. Top notes are Neroli, Pink Pepper and Mandarin Orange; middle notes are Rose, Ylang-Ylang and Tuberose; base notes are Sandalwood, Patchouli and Musk.
